Similar Listings
2011 Tiguan Engine Computer Control Module ECU 123K Miles OE - LKQ417379644
2011 Ridgeline Engine Computer Control Module ECU 104K Miles OE - LKQ434597316
2011 Yaris Engine Computer Control Module ECU 104K Miles OE - LKQ393827706
2011 Pilot Engine Computer Control Module ECU 104K Miles OE - LKQ405452539
2011 Legacy Engine Computer Control Module ECU 104K Miles OE - LKQ419942735
2011 Mazda 3 Engine Computer Control Module ECU 104K Miles OE - LKQ385950833
2011 Ram 1500 Engine Computer Control Module ECU 126K Miles OE - LKQ451960590
2011 Escape Engine Computer Control Module ECU 104K Miles OE - LKQ422323864